开发者证书签名怎么弄?
在开发移动应用程序的过程中,开发者证书签名是一个不可或缺的步骤。无论是iOS还是Android平台,签名证书都用于验证应用的身份和完整性,确保用户下载的应用是经过开发者授权的版本。那么,具体该如何操作呢?接下来,我们将分步骤为您详细解析。
一、明确需求与准备工具
首先,您需要确定自己的开发环境。如果是针对iOS平台,您需要通过Apple Developer Program获取开发者证书;而对于Android,则需要创建一个Keystore文件。此外,您还需要安装相应的开发工具,如Xcode(适用于iOS)或Android Studio(适用于Android)。
二、生成开发者证书
1. iOS平台
- 登录Apple Developer官网,进入证书管理页面。
- 根据您的需求选择合适的证书类型(如App Store发布证书或Ad Hoc测试证书)。
- 下载生成的证书并安装到Keychain Access中。
- 在Xcode项目设置中,将此证书绑定至您的应用。
2. Android平台
- 打开Android Studio,进入“Build”菜单,选择“Generate Signed Bundle/APK”。
- 创建一个新的Keystore文件,并为其设置密码。
- 使用该Keystore为APK签名,并保存生成的签名文件。
三、注意事项
在进行证书签名时,有几点需要特别注意:
- 安全性:证书文件和密码必须妥善保管,避免泄露。
- 有效期:定期检查证书的有效期,及时更新以保证应用正常运行。
- 兼容性:确保签名后的应用与目标设备的操作系统版本兼容。
四、总结
开发者证书签名虽然看似繁琐,但却是保障应用质量和用户信任的重要环节。无论是在iOS还是Android平台上,只要按照上述步骤操作,就能顺利完成签名流程。希望本文能帮助您更好地理解这一过程,并在实际开发中游刃有余。
如果您在操作过程中遇到任何问题,欢迎随时查阅官方文档或寻求社区支持。祝您开发顺利!
这篇内容既涵盖了基础知识,又提供了实际操作指南,同时保持了语言流畅且易于理解,希望能满足您的需求!